GYUMRI. – Out of 116 accidents occurred in the first half of this year in Gyumri, 40.8 percent are of anthropogenic character, during which six people died. 103 accidents were registered last year, during which 9 people died.
A total of 72 people (83.1 % of total number) were injured this year as a result of anthropogenic accidents, while the number was 60 (47.1 %) in 2010. Out of 43 cases of fire (2010 recorded 44 cases), 17 were registered in Gyumri. No one died of fires. Rescue department of Gyumri city reported during the session.
